About  one hundred years ago it took a lot of time to travel from one town to the other. Sometimes it took weeks to get from one country to the other.The trip itself was dangerous and tiresome. As time passed everything changed.
Nowadays you can reach the other side of the planet  just in some hours. Now there is a wide choice of means of transport. You can travel by land, by sea,  by air. Of course the fastest way of travelling is by plane. It will take you only about six - nine hours to get to the USA, which is situated very far from our country!
Travelling by train or by car  is slower, than by plane, but you can enjoy picturesque landscapes during the trip.
Most people think that travelling is one of the most splendid things in the world.Travellig  gives us life experience. It broadens our mind and allows us to understand other people better, to see other countries and different sights, to taste unusual  and exotic food, improve some foreign language, meet new  people, make new friends,  take interesting photos and selfi . I like visiting new places, museums, churches, monuments and other sights.Travelling is useful and it's fun.

Kazakhstan is committed to becoming one of the top 30 of the world’s 50 developing nations by 2050. A “greening” of essential economic sectors is part and parcel of this economic drive. As an oil producing nation, moving from “brown” to green status will be a challenge – one that Kazakhstan is ready to face head on.

 

President Nazarbayev formally adopted Kazakhstan’s Green Economy Concept policy in 2013, following the Rio+20 Earth Summit in 2012. With full presidential backing, it appears the Central Asian state is firmly committed to “cleaning up” its economy.
